Use of College Facilities

 

ºÚÁϳԹÏ’s facilities, including campus grounds, are provided for the support of the regular educational functions of the college and the activities necessary for the support of these functions. College functions take precedence over other activities. Sometimes community groups not affiliated with ºÚÁÏ³Ô¹Ï conduct workshops and seminars in college facilities. College facilities may be used by private organizations (non-NSHE groups) subject to availability, an administrative fee, and proof of liability insurance. Before the institution approves the use of a ºÚÁÏ³Ô¹Ï facility by any outside person or entity (applicant), the applicant shall state, in writing, whether or not the program or activity is a children’s program and the level of the children’s program, as defined in the policy. If it is a children’s program, ºÚÁÏ³Ô¹Ï shall provide a copy of this procedure and the NSHE policy regarding the protection of children and the applicant shall state in writing the person or entity’s procedures for the protection of children. The Vice President for Finance and Operations shall review the information provided and may deny the applicant the use of a ºÚÁÏ³Ô¹Ï facility if the policies or procedures are inadequate. No approval of any room use request will be issued until after the Vice President for Finance and Operations or designee has reviewed all documents.
